WebFor DOD grants: Policy Reference: For grants that incorporate OMB’s Uniform Guidance, the reference would be 2CFR 200.308 (c) (3). For DOD contracts: Normally, DOD contracts include a clause that names specific individuals and describes the requirements for requesting sponsor approval for any change in key personnel.
